Output 51735a80c74bb251ab340f3690287fda374b71178e0f16e8a502a1948cfb6389:0

value
430373926
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 502f5c943dda83811b409384f14efb5e762f3efb OP_EQUALVERIFY OP_CHECKSIG
address
18Jyo6FzG9JkDaS2Xgi6WouKR4MrL5WMeX
transaction
51735a80c74bb251ab340f3690287fda374b71178e0f16e8a502a1948cfb6389
spent
true